What is conversion rate optimization (cro)?

Definition

Conversion Rate Optimization (CRO) is Conversion rate optimization (CRO) is the practice of systematically testing and improving the percentage of website visitors who complete a desired action — signup, purchase, demo request — through A/B testing, heatmap analysis, and iterative copy and design changes.

Also known as: CRO, conversion testing, growth experimentation

Why it matters

CRO is the discipline of getting more from the same traffic. A site converting at 2% with 10,000 monthly visitors generates 200 customers; the same site at 4% generates 400. Doubling conversion is almost always cheaper than doubling traffic, which is why CRO compounds returns faster than acquisition spend.

What conversion rate optimization (cro) includes

  • A baseline measurement of current conversion rate by funnel step, segment, and device.
  • Hypothesis-driven A/B tests on hero copy, CTAs, social proof placement, form length, and pricing presentation.
  • Heatmap and session recording analysis (Hotjar, FullStory) to identify where visitors hesitate or drop off.
  • Statistical significance discipline — tests run to a minimum sample size before winners are declared.
  • An iteration loop: winning variants replace baselines; losing variants inform the next hypothesis.

When a business needs conversion rate optimization (cro)

CRO applies to any commercial website with measurable traffic (typically 5,000+ monthly visitors for meaningful test velocity). It is most valuable for businesses where the conversion event is high-value — SaaS, B2B services, high-ticket DTC. Low-volume or pre-revenue sites should prioritize building a high-converting baseline first, then optimize.

Common questions

How long should an A/B test run before declaring a winner?
Until it reaches statistical significance at the sample size your traffic supports — typically 2-4 weeks for most B2B sites. Cutting tests short on early signal is the most common CRO mistake; many 'winners' regress to baseline once traffic doubles.
What conversion lift is realistic from a CRO program?
Quarter-over-quarter, well-run CRO programs typically lift conversion 10-30% in the first six months. Beyond that, lifts are smaller but compound. Site rebuilds that integrate conversion-focused design at the foundation usually beat incremental CRO on a fully-optimized old site.
